Output ed668b3dfcfff272ffa4acbe1971425452c31697252808680bf09d3ebb7e8216:0

value
2623255
script pubkey
OP_0 OP_PUSHBYTES_20 9fccd4163c9360bdc006b146c620c66a2c2a7705
address
bc1qnlxdg93ujdstmsqxk9rvvgxxdgkz5ac9tlzg86
transaction
ed668b3dfcfff272ffa4acbe1971425452c31697252808680bf09d3ebb7e8216
confirmations
322973
spent
true